Navigating the Technical Aspects of 3D Printing Sacred Art
While the concept is straightforward, achieving a high-quality print of the Sagrado Coracao De Jesus requires attention to technical details. The model is described as having "riqueza de detalhes" (richness of details), which implies fine features that may challenge lower-resolution printers or improper settings. To ensure the final piece truly reflects the dignity of the subject matter, users should consider the following best practices:
- Slicer Preparation: Before sending the file to the printer, it is essential to review the model in your slicing software. Check for overhangs that may require support structures. While the file is optimized, complex areas like the fingers or the flames may benefit from tree supports to preserve detail without leaving significant marks.
- Material Selection: The choice of filament affects both the appearance and durability of the statue. PLA is easy to print and comes in various colors, including skin tones and whites. For a more premium look, PETG or ASA can offer better heat resistance and a smoother finish, though they may require higher printing temperatures.
- Orientation: Printing the model upright may provide the best surface quality for the front face, but it might require extensive supports. Printing it at an angle can reduce support contact points on critical areas, such as the face or the heart itself, resulting in a cleaner final product.
- Post-Processing: Once printed, careful removal of supports and light sanding can enhance the model’s appearance. For those inclined, painting the statue allows for complete artistic control, enabling the creator to highlight specific symbolic elements like the red of the heart or the gold of the halo.
